Harveys work, supplemented with the discovery of the capillariesand that of the lymphatic system, marks a new era in physiology. Itrevolutionized the whole subject, for now the examination of theexchanges between the blood of the organs and tissues of the bodybecame possible. The idea of spirits ought to have disappeared,but it did not. The very title of his work suggests the wide viewHarvey took of the problem ; Harvey made accurate anatomicalobservations and planned experiments to test his hypotheses, and hemade-abundant use of his knowledge of comparative anatomy, andwith convincing results.
